A long wire carrying a 5.4 A current perpendicular to the xy-plane intersects the x-axis at x = -2.0cm. A second, parallel wire carrying a 2.0 A current intersects the x-axis at x+2.0cm. Part A At what point on the x-axis is the magnetic field zero if the two currents are in the same direction? Express your answer with the appropriate units.
